Green Goo Tattoo Care is a 4 oz all-natural aftercare ointment designed specifically for new tattoos. Infused with soothing ingredients like Aloe Vera, Myrrh, and Yarrow, it helps alleviate pain and swelling while keeping your tattoo colors vibrant and fresh. This eco-friendly product is cruelty-free and paraben-free, making it a responsible choice for tattoo enthusiasts.

Great but with one exception
Love this product. It's hydrating and persistent. On bare/exposed skin hours later I can still feel where I applied it. Even inside a shirt sleeve it won't be as evident but your skin will still be hydrated. I have not found it to stain any clothing either. I use Recovery Derm Shield, then this, power past the dry and flaking stage. Vibrant and healed.That all being said, the size of container matters!! The smaller tin is like a pomade or shoe polish. It stays firmer through the life of the tin. You could smoosh it up but I found it to be more resilient. The bigger jar turned into a slurry on me in a week, like honey or syrup. If tipped it'll pour right out, unlike the tin which I would routinely turn upside-down to pop it back on it's lid. Both were kept in the same climate-controlled bathroom. Maybe I got a bad jar, but on my skin it feels and smells like the same product. Just a VERY different consistency.

Helped me through the scary scabbing and flaking week!
The pics are from moments after completion of the tattoo and about 2 weeks after. I started with Aquaphor but it felt thick and was mostly petroleum jelly. A friend recommended this and I'm glad they did.I'm a bit older to be getting a piece this large (52) so my skin isn't perfect for healing. After a week the piece really started to scab and peel even while it was plenty covered with salve - it was scary but I kept being good about washing and reapplying the Green Goo. Now, almost two weeks later all the rough patches that wanted to peel have washed away at their own pace and my tattoo remains just as bold. I've read that the ink will get lighter after two more weeks.I'm not sure what to say about the most popular negative review saying that the tattoo didn't heal at all. I guess everyone's body chemistry is different. It worked for me and I'll use it for my next one.
